Transaction 78da30903a13d5b88adae91550fd81c26bdd165432d8353675a54be721ed1ac7
1 Input
1 Output
-
78da30903a13d5b88adae91550fd81c26bdd165432d8353675a54be721ed1ac7:0
- value
- 95411
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d1ac4287d942b9f224b5cb03e18564bd5755be06 OP_EQUAL
- address
- 3LofWTohndMY3N5cjZHLFKM8coo98EMu56